Between Brisbane and the Gold Coast they are building massive housing estates without at the same time building the required transport infrastructure. As new build estates there is no excuse for building car only housing estates. You need to build this as you develop as it becomes difficult to install after the event. The developers will have moved on and the residents and council will be left with the inbuilt problems
It isn't happening just between Brisbane and the Gold Coast,it is happening all over SE Qld,probably most of the state, and all over Australia.
Yarrabilba is another that comes to mind close to here,thousands of homes built in the last few years,with virtually no public transport to the area,and the same old single lane road running out there,from Waterford,for around 8Km,at a guess.

Will be interesting to see if the infrastructure spending for the 2032 Olympics improves the transport situation.
The SEQ mayors cooked up the plan for the Olympics as a way of getting funding approved for the infrastructure they know the region needs.
Work has started on the upgrade at the Landsborough rail station parking area, to become an overpass as part of fast rail to Nambour, so things are happening.
